[CIVIL WAR] Captured Port Royal Cigar Holder

Brass cigar holder. Approx. length 1 in. WITH Manuscript pencil note which reads in full: "Cigar Holder / Taken from Captain's Tent [?] after battle at Port Royal S.C. Nov. 7/61 by ?? G. Adams attached to Steamer Susquehanna. / Jany 10/14."

 

The U.S.S. Susquehanna was part of the main fleet that arrived on November 7th and attacked the Confederate-held forts. Fort Walker was abandoned by mid-afternoon and crews went ashore and raised the Union flag.
